Best Gulf Coast Beaches in Florida

Florida's Gulf Coast is renowned for white sand and calm, clear water: (1) Siesta Key Beach (Sarasota) — consistently ranked #1 U.S. beach; quartz sand that stays cool even in summer; stunning clear Gulf water. (2) Clearwater Beach — most visited Florida beach; award-winning water quality; vibrant Pier 60 area. (3) St. Pete Beach — Fort De Soto Park has some of Florida's most pristine undeveloped beach. (4) Naples Beach — upscale, quieter Gulf beach with iconic pier. (5) Destin/30A — Panhandle beaches with emerald-green water and sugar-white sand; Henderson Beach, Crystal Beach, Grayton Beach.

Best Atlantic and Southeast Florida Beaches

East coast beaches have stronger surf and Atlantic character: (1) South Beach (Miami Beach) — iconic; Art Deco architecture, vibrant nightlife, warm azure water. (2) Delray Beach — smaller, local character; less crowded than Fort Lauderdale/Miami; charming Atlantic Avenue. (3) Jupiter Beach — natural feel; manatee sightings; less developed than Palm Beach County neighbors. (4) New Smyrna Beach — surf capital of the East Coast; artsy town character; excellent food scene. (5) Cocoa Beach — Space Coast; surf culture; Kennedy Space Center proximity.

What is the clearest water beach in Florida?
The clearest water is in the Florida Panhandle — Destin, 30A (Grayton Beach, Seaside, Rosemary Beach), and Fort Walton Beach. The emerald-green, crystal-clear water comes from the white quartz sand and shallow depths of the Gulf at those latitudes.
What is the best family beach in Florida?
Clearwater Beach and Siesta Key Beach consistently rank as the best family beaches in Florida — calm, clear Gulf water; lifeguards; excellent facilities; nearby restaurants and rentals.
Which Florida beach is least crowded?
Florida's least crowded quality beaches: Caladesi Island State Park (accessible only by ferry or boat), Cumberland Island (Georgia border), Fort De Soto Park (Tierra Verde), and sections of Canaveral National Seashore. These protected areas see far less traffic than developed beach cities.
Are Florida beach homes a good investment?
Historically yes — Florida beachfront and beach-proximate properties have strong appreciation and rental income potential. The risks: high insurance costs (wind, flood), sea level and erosion concerns, and HOA restrictions on short-term rentals. Research insurance costs carefully before buying beachfront.
